| The XML family of languages is being created by adapting
existing international publishing standards for use on the
Web. - XML (Extensible Markup Language): A subset of
SGML (ISO 8879) designed for easy implementation
- XLL (Extensible Linking Language): A set of
standard hypertext mechanisms based on HyTime (ISO/IEC
10744) and the Text Encoding Initiative (TEI)
- XSL (Extensible Stylesheet Language): A
standard stylesheet language for structured information
formed by subsetting DSSSL (ISO/IEC 10179), designing an
alternative syntax, and incorporating key CSS concepts
